What an affiliate link is
Some of the outbound links to operators on this site are affiliate links. They point to the operator’s own website and carry tracking parameters that tell the operator the visit came from us. If you follow one of those links and then register an account or place a bet, the operator may pay us a commission.
What it costs you
Nothing. You pay the same prices and get the same terms as anyone arriving at the operator directly. The commission is paid by the operator out of its own marketing budget, not added to your stake or deducted from any winnings.
The important bit: affiliate commission does not buy a higher score, a better review or a fixed place in our comparison. Scores follow our editorial review policy and the same checks are applied to every product, paid link or not.
